JOB DESCRIPTION

As a Regulatory Strategy Officer within the Governance and Business Management team, you will play a pivotal role in shaping the strategic direction of the team. You will be overseeing several important functions including business management, and the Regulatory Engagement Manager governance. You will have close interactions with the exam team leads, the team admins and the onsite examiner team. To be successful in this role, you will need to think strategically about optimizing the management of the function, possess exceptional communication skills, be capable of working in a fast paced environment, and driving initiatives to conclusion. Additionally, you will be responsible for cultivating expertise in the firm's regulatory agenda and acquire a comprehensive understanding of governance at a firm-wide level.

 

Job Responsibilities

  • Support traditional business management responsibilities for the broader team including but not limited to driving strategic planning and execution, budgeting and forecasting, headcount management, expense management, business reviews, crisis and business resiliency, and real estate planning.

  • Coordinate communications related to team and broader Compliance, Conduct and Operational Risk (CCOR) related business management priorities to the team. 

  • Support control environment responsibilities, including oversight of the team’s controls, and quarterback any related testing by control management and audit 

  • Support culture initiatives by organizing impactful trainings, townhalls, offsites, etc.

  • Support regulatory engagement management governance which includes oversight to the 4 standards/procedures owned by Regulatory Strategy

  • Support exam operations as needed

  • Manage agendas for governance meetings 

  • Manage delivery and execution of several important regulator deliverables, including Resolution Planning/Appendix 21, coordination of crisis management notifications to US primary regulators; coordinate the planning and execution of the bi-annual College of Supervisors meetings; and managing submission of certain information to regulators.

About JP Morgan Chase & Co.

JP Morgan Chase & Co. stands at the forefront of the global financial services industry. They offer an expansive array of products and services to a diverse clientele, including individuals, corporations, governments, and institutions. Ever since the merger of J.P. Morgan & Co. and Chase Manhattan Corporation in 2000, this industry-leading entity has become renowned for its comprehensive portfolio encompassing consumer and community banking, corporate and investment banking, commercial banking, as well as asset and wealth management. Headquartered in the vibrant city of New York, JP Morgan Chase & Co. boasts a formidable presence across over 100 countries worldwide.
